Output d66d348a5fc361dd8b39689c233527c3bfc613084edd3669e21ff096097b2012:8

value
2400000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 bf9c1eafcc557303a9b04768397ee3454778d81a OP_EQUALVERIFY OP_CHECKSIG
address
1JU963DzD9xwNZHDRELS5J7g95jKqA4dsQ
transaction
d66d348a5fc361dd8b39689c233527c3bfc613084edd3669e21ff096097b2012
spent
true